RICHMOND REACHES MILESTONE IN WIN OVER AQUINAS January 26, 2013 For Immediate Release Box score Fort Wayne, Ind. – Junior Ulyssia Richmond (Temple Hills, MD/Riverdale Baptist) became the latest Indiana Tech women’s basketball player to reach 1,000 career points in helping the Lady Warriors to an 81-74 victory over conference foe Aquinas College on Saturday. Richmond, who entered the contest needing just four points to reach the milestone, connected from behind the arc at the 17:23 mark to tie the game 5-5. Just over three minutes later, she buried a jumper to put her over 1,000 points. The basket came as part of a 9-0 run which gave the Warriors the lead for good. Holding an eight point lead with four minutes remaining in the opening period, Tech outscored the Saints 14-5 the rest of the way to take a 44-27 advantage into halftime. The Warriors scorched the nets in the first half shooting 59 percent from the field, and went 5-for-10 from three-point range, while Aquinas hit just 37 percent of their shots. The second half was a different story though as the Saints reversed the trend and knocked down half of their field goals, including four triples to climb back into the game. Tech extended its lead to 22 at the 12:12 mark, but the Saints slowly worked their way back cutting the deficit to three with less than two minutes left on the clock. Rachael Kruse (Ft. Wayne, IN/Homestead) and Chelsea Carradine (Redford, MI/Thurston) would answer though with clutch buckets, and Preonda Reese (Ft. Wayne, IN/Northrop) would put the game away at the free throw line. Kruse finished with a team-high 20 points followed by Richmond and Rayana Villalpando (Bellflower, CA/Downey) with 14 apiece, which was a season-high for Villalpando. Carradine and Kaneisha Bass (Detroit, MI/Lincoln Trail) cleaned up the class for the Warriors racking up seven rebounds each.
